Not only are we left gobsmacked by Lisa Jane Millinery fabulous designs but we were also amazed at her incredibly long list of appearances in magazine editorials and catwalks with various designers. Lisa's designs are often quirky and always eye-catching as you can see in the images featured. Don't just take our word for it, here we have 10 quick questions with the very talented Lisa Jayne Millinery.

1. What do you love most about Millinery?
I love the creative freedom you have in millinery one is only limited by their own imagination.

2. How did you get into Millinery?
I originally studied art/design specialising in fashion/textiles then I went on to study costume it was whilst on this course we did a term of theatrical millinery. I was hooked. I then studied a further two years the art of millinery.

3.How you would describe your designs.
I would say my favourite designs are avant-garde

4. What is your ideal customer?
I love someone who is not afraid to stand out in a crowd who wants to be noticed.

5. What inspires you?
I love when someone contacts me and gives me a theme they are working on and asks me to create something inspired by that theme, many designers ask me to compliment their work so I then do my own research based on their theme whilst keeping in mind their collection.

6. If you could invite any milliner to tea who would it be?
Stephen Jones.

7. What is your favourite material to work with?
I don't have a particular favourite although I do love to up-cycle and recycle so I have been known to make headwear from CDs and plastic bottles.

8. Whats your best millinery tip?
Learn your art then be experimental.

9. If you had to make your last hat what would it be?
Something spectacular go out on a high.

10. Famous words to live by.
Love what you do, then you will never feel like your working another day in your life.
